Is there a way to allow my wife and 2 kids to view the iCloud photo library on their iOS devices?

We each have a different AppleID and under mine I have iCloud photos turned on with a storage limit of 200Gb to cover the 20k photos.

I can see the option of sharing a moment or adding individual photos to a newly created shared album but I would like them to see the folder setup like that on my device.

Sadly, no. You have to use "Shared" albums.

I think this is Apple's attempt to limit the bandwidth suck of multiple people viewing and downloading full size photos from a single paying iCloud storage account.

I would gladly pay them double for my storage plan (50GB/$0.99 per month) to have my wife be able to fully access my iCloud Photo Library.
